0.1.1 • Published 10 months ago

cheapskate v0.1.1

Weekly downloads
-
License
MIT
Repository
gitlab
Last release
10 months ago

Cheapskate

Low-budget user interface animation

Not for production use

This is not a robust enough abstraction to be suited for any use case other than the given examples.

This does not work in Firefox due to an implementation detail they call “Interruptible Layout” but should work in Chromium-based browsers.

Examples

Live demo: kevindoughty.gitlab.io/preact-sibling-animation

Preact: gitlab.com/kevindoughty/preact-sibling-animation

Svelte: gitlab.com/kevindoughty/svelte-four-sibling-animation

Todo

  1. Tests
  2. Documentation
  3. Allow delegate to specify enter/exit animation
  4. Allow delegate to specify stagger
  5. CSS for exit animation needs to properly consider box-sizing and properties that affect metrics, which are determined by offsetLeft and offsetTop
  6. Drag-reorder siblings
  7. Trees
  8. Virtualize
0.1.0

10 months ago

0.1.1

10 months ago

0.0.17

11 months ago

0.0.15

11 months ago

0.0.16

11 months ago

0.0.13

12 months ago

0.0.14

12 months ago

0.0.10

12 months ago

0.0.11

12 months ago

0.0.12

12 months ago

0.0.9

12 months ago

0.0.8

12 months ago

0.0.7

12 months ago

0.0.6

12 months ago

0.0.5

12 months ago

0.0.4

12 months ago

0.0.3

12 months ago

0.0.2

12 months ago

0.0.1

12 months ago